Benedetta Chiodini is a scholar working on Surgery, Immunology and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Benedetta Chiodini has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 432 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Surgery, 4 papers in Immunology and 4 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health. Recurrent topics in Benedetta Chiodini’s work include Renal Diseases and Glomerulopathies (3 papers), Biomedical Research and Pathophysiology (2 papers) and Lipoproteins and Cardiovascular Health (2 papers). Benedetta Chiodini is often cited by papers focused on Renal Diseases and Glomerulopathies (3 papers), Biomedical Research and Pathophysiology (2 papers) and Lipoproteins and Cardiovascular Health (2 papers). Benedetta Chiodini collaborates with scholars based in Belgium, Italy and United Kingdom. Benedetta Chiodini's co-authors include Cathryn M. Lewis, Khalid Ismaïli, R. Fiocchi, Alessandro Rambaldi, Teresio Motta, Brigitte Adams, Giovanna Gavazzeni, Tiziano Barbui, Gianpietro Dotti and Simona Barlera and has published in prestigious journals such as PEDIATRICS, European Heart Journal and Arteriosclerosis Thrombosis and Vascular Biology.
